What are apprenticeships?
Apprenticeships are work based training programmes that help
young adults learn or improve their skills in order to get ahead
while earning an allowance.
There are two levels of apprenticeship:
- Apprenticeship (NVQ level 2).
- Advanced Apprenticeship (NVQ level 3).

Can any of my existing staff apply for an apprenticeship?
Providing your staff are aged 16-24, they may be eligible to
begin an apprenticeship.
